Sustainable Fashion: The Future of Apparel Exports
The shift towards sustainable fashion is more than just a trend; it's becoming a necessity in the apparel export industry. As consumers become more eco-conscious, B2B suppliers must adapt their strategies to include sustainability in their product offerings.
Importance of Sustainability in Apparel Exports
Understanding the importance of sustainability in the apparel export sector is crucial for B2B suppliers. Not only does it meet consumer demands, but it also reduces environmental impact. By sourcing materials that are organic or recycled, suppliers can cater to a market that values ethical practices.
Implementing Sustainable Practices
Incorporating sustainable practices doesn’t have to be complex. B2B suppliers can start by evaluating their supply chain for more sustainable options. This includes choosing manufacturers that adhere to ethical labor standards and utilizing eco-friendly packaging.
Marketing Sustainable Products
Once sustainable practices are in place, B2B suppliers should focus on marketing these eco-friendly products effectively. Highlighting the sustainable aspects of apparel can attract eco-conscious clients and differentiate suppliers from competitors in the global market.
